When it comes to designing and manufacturing electronic devices, having the right enclosure is crucial. Not only does it protect the internal components from external elements, but it also plays a key role in the overall functionality and aesthetics of the device. One popular choice for enclosures is sheet metal due to its durability, versatility, and cost-effectiveness. In this article, we will explore the benefits of using a sheet metal enclosure for your project.
Durability is one of the main reasons why sheet metal enclosures are a popular choice among manufacturers. Sheet metal, typically made from steel or aluminum, is known for its high strength and resistance to corrosion. This makes it ideal for protecting electronic components from dust, moisture, and other potentially harmful elements. sheet metal enclosures are also able to withstand a wide range of temperatures, making them suitable for use in various environments.
Versatility is another key advantage of using a sheet metal enclosure. Sheet metal can be easily customized to fit specific requirements, whether it is size, shape, or design. This allows manufacturers to create enclosures that perfectly fit the dimensions of their electronic devices, maximizing space utilization and ensuring a sleek, professional look. In addition, sheet metal can be easily fabricated using various techniques such as cutting, bending, welding, and powder coating, giving manufacturers the flexibility to design enclosures that meet their exact specifications.
Cost-effectiveness is a major consideration for any project, and sheet metal enclosures offer great value for money. Sheet metal is readily available and cost-effective to produce, making it a practical choice for mass production. Despite its affordability, sheet metal is incredibly durable and long-lasting, reducing the need for frequent replacements and repairs. This not only saves money in the long run but also minimizes downtime and maintenance costs for electronic devices.
In addition to durability, versatility, and cost-effectiveness, sheet metal enclosures offer excellent electromagnetic interference (EMI) shielding properties. EMI can interfere with the normal operation of electronic devices, leading to malfunctions and reduced performance. sheet metal enclosures act as a barrier against EMI, ensuring that internal components are protected from external electromagnetic fields. This is particularly important for sensitive electronic devices that require high levels of reliability and performance.
Furthermore, sheet metal enclosures are environmentally friendly and sustainable. Steel and aluminum, the most common materials used for sheet metal fabrication, are 100% recyclable. This means that at the end of their lifecycle, sheet metal enclosures can be easily recycled and repurposed, reducing waste and minimizing the impact on the environment.
